"Jesus told them, 'You're all going to feel that your world is falling apart and that it's my fault. There's a Scripture that says, "I will strike the Shepherd; The sheep will go helter-skelter."'" Mark 14:27 (The Message)
Someone at your workplace finds out your're a Christian and begins to persecute you. It hurts. It may even anger you but you've chosen to "turn the other cheek." It only gets worse. The persecutor attacks Jesus' name with ridicule and lies, and, he's now gotten others to join him. What do you do now? Do you get angry with God because He won't defend Himself? Do you feel so all alone and scared that you retreat? You're no different than the original disciples. That didn't change His love for them; and, it doesn't change His love for you. It didn't alter His purpose and calling for them; and, it won't for you. It did make them realize that without the power of God given to them, they, in and of themselves, could do nothing. So must you , dear Christian. They were told to wait for "another Comforter." They gathered, they prayed, they waited--and, they received the power to be witnesses of Jesus Christ. Think about it.
